Freedom of Religion, Government-Sponsored Religion, Religious Right Research

What is it with Religious Right zealots and holidays?

In recent weeks, Focus on the Family, the American Family Association and other Religious Right zealots have ginned up their annual assault on “Happy Holidays.” In a shameless bid to raise money and add a dollop of bitterness to the Christmas season, these folks are DEMANDING that merchants use the […] Read More